Math EOG
Vocabulary
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Equation (Number Sentence) | a mathmatical sentence with an equal sign |
| Solve | to answer an equation |
| Sum | the amswer to an addition equation |
| Difference | the answer to a subtraction equation |
| Factor | numbers that are multiplied |
| Product | answer to a multiplication problem |
| Factor Pairs | 2 numbers multiplied together to get a product |
| Multiples | a group of products for a number multiplises of 4: 4, 8, 12, 16, 20... |
| Division | taking a large number and separating it into equal groups |
| Divisor | the number that is to be divided by (the amount of groups) |
| Quotient | the answer to a division problem; the amount in each equal group |
| Remainder | the amount that is left over from the equal groups when you divide |
| Fraction | part of a whole |
| Numerator | the top number in a fraction |
| Denominator | the bottom number in a fraction |
| Equivalent | having the same value (=) |
| Improper Fraction | when the denominator is smaller than or equal to the numerator |
| Mixed Number | a number containing a whole number and a fraction |
| Area | the measurement of the inside of a shape A= L x W |
| Primeter | the measurement of the outside of a shape P = add all sides |
| Rounding | estimate 0-4 stay the same 5-9 go up 1 |
| Obtuse Angle | an angle larger than 90 degress |
| Acute Angle | an angle smaller than 90 degrees |
| Right Angle | an angle that equals 90 degrees |
| Parellel Lines | a pair of lines that never cross |
| Perpendicular Lines | lines that cross and form a 90 degree angle |
| Intersenting Lines | lines that cross and do not measure 90 degrees |
| Ray | part of a line with an end point and the other end goes on forever |
| Point | a location on a line |
| Line | a straight path that goes on forever in both directions |
| Line Segment | part of a line with two end points |
| Symmetry | when something is the same on both sides of the line of symmetry |
| Straight Angle | an angle that equals 180 degrees |
| End Point | a point that marks the end of a ray or line segment |
| = | equal to |
| > | greater than |
| < | less than |
